21xrx.com
2024-12-22 16:09:18 Sunday
登录
文章检索 我的文章 写文章
FFmpeg 标准输出
2023-07-27 01:16:44 深夜i     --     --
FFmpeg 标准输出 视频转码 音频处理 多媒体操作

FFmpeg 是一款开源的多媒体处理工具,它提供了各种功能用于编辑、转码和处理音视频文件。在使用 FFmpeg 进行处理时,我们可以通过标准输出来查看处理进程的详细信息。

标准输出是指程序执行时默认输出到屏幕上的信息。在 FFmpeg 中,默认情况下,处理进程中的详细信息会以文本形式输出到控制台,即标准输出。这些信息包括了输入文件的信息、处理过程的进展和结果,以及警告和错误等。

通过查看标准输出,我们可以了解到处理进程的实时状态,并可以根据输出的信息进行相应的调整和优化。例如,当我们进行文件转码时,标准输出可以显示转码的进展情况,如开始时间、已处理的帧数、转码速度等。通过实时查看标准输出,我们可以判断转码是否有异常,以及调整参数是否合适,从而决定是否需要中止转码或进行调整。

此外,标准输出中的警告和错误信息也是我们关注的重点。当出现错误时,标准输出会显示错误的类型和具体的错误信息,例如输入文件格式不支持、编码器不可用等。通过查看错误信息,我们可以及时发现问题,并进行相应的处理。对于一些常见的错误,FFmpeg 通常也会给出相应的解决方案。

在使用 FFmpeg 进行处理时,我们可以通过一些参数来控制标准输出的显示方式。例如,可以设置日志级别,以决定输出信息的详细程度。最低级别是 quiet,表示只显示错误信息;最高级别是 debug,表示显示最详细的信息。根据需求,我们可以自由选择输出信息的详细程度,以便更好地进行调试和优化。

总之,FFmpeg 的标准输出对于我们了解处理进程的状态和结果至关重要。通过实时查看标准输出,我们可以及时发现错误和问题,并进行相应的调整和处理。同时,合理利用标准输出中的信息,我们还可以对处理参数进行优化,以提高处理速度和质量。因此,学会使用 FFmpeg 标准输出,并善加利用其中的信息,对于科学高效地使用 FFmpeg 是非常重要的。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复